History

The Sycamore Plaza Library Branch, located in Violet Township opened to the public on September 2, 2017. This is the second location of the Pickerington Public Library and serves the northern halves of Violet Township and City of Pickerington.

Funding for the library’s branch was made possible thanks to a donation from the late Mary Blauser Meilwes, whose family once owned the land at 201 Opportunity Way, where the Pickerington Main Library is currently located.

The 4,200 square foot space provides a full range of services to the community, including a Homework Help Center, meeting room space, wireless printing, and notary services, in addition to its collection of books, DVDs, and more, for all ages.
